2. Refund Ratio

Tracking refunds is crucial for assessing vendor reliability and product quality. A simple division formula calculates the refund ratio as a percentage of total orders or spending.

Example Formula:=(Total_Refund_Amount / Total_Spending) * 100

3. QC (Quality Control) Performance

Assign QC scores or flag items as Pass/Fail. The spreadsheet can then calculate the pass rate percentage, helping you identify quality trends over time or by supplier.

Example Formula:=(COUNTIF(QC_Range, "Pass") / COUNTA(QC_Range)) * 100
